2915 Wickersham Way #102, 22042 Falls Church, VA United States
USA Lock & Key
https://usalockandkeys.com/
RankLabel connects customers with local businesses in Saginaw, TX. Find and advertise your business on with RankLabel – Business Directory Saginaw, TX.